The Shock Fall of Sam Bankman-Fried: A 5-point Digest on the FTX Co-founder’s Downfall

One of the brightest stars in the crypto world, Sam Bankman-Fried, co-founder of the crypto exchange FTX and trading firm Alameda Research, dramatically fell from grace recently. Taking a diverging path from legitimate investments into the world of fraud and money laundering, he has been met with a stern judging hand, resulting in a 25-year sentence.     2. The Charges: Fraud and Money Laundering

    Despite his glittering image, the former CEO of FTX was proven guilty on seven counts relating to fraud and money laundering. The repercussions were severe, revealing a dark underbelly to the crypto world’s success stories. Transparency and trust in the cryptocurrency field were undeniably shaken.

    3. The Long Arm of Justice: A 25-Year Sentence

    Bankman-Fried’s court battle ended in a resounding defeat. He was sentenced to a staggering 25 years in prison by Judge Lewis Kaplan of the Southern District of New York (SDNY). The lengthy sentence reflects the severe view taken by the judicial system on such deceitful practices in the increasingly regulated crypto market.
